#fa8f42 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a8f42 is composed of 98% red, 56.1%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.8%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 25.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 62%. #fa8f42 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ff84 with #f51f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#fa8f42 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fa8f42 has RGB values of R:250, G:143,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.74,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16420674.

Shades and Tints of #fa8f42

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fff5ee is the lightest one.
